Born into fortune and wealth, the sixteen-year-old Arabella Wynters staggers through the luxurious life her parents have set out for her. Her parents have high expectations for her future and the weight on her shoulders weighs heavily. Found at the door step of a foster home, sixteen-year-old Aidenn Emberwood desperately longs to know who his parents are and who he is. Growing up with trust issues, his defiant attitude towards everything is about to get him into serious trouble. From very different worlds Aidenn and Arabella have no reason to cross paths. Until the day where both of them discover the ability to hone a supernatural power and they are both kidnapped by unknown beings. Their strengths, wits, and personalities are put to the test in the ultimate race for survival against the people who perceive them as a threat. Their real enemies will be discovered and so will their dark and devastating backgrounds.
